Assess local and regional tolerance for intranasal, oral vaccines. • If the adjuvant itself is immunogenic, tests may be indicated for hypersensitivity 1 e.g. passive cutaneous anaphylaxis, active systemic anaphylaxis assays, IgE measures, and dermal sensitization potential. • Test the adjuvant for pyrogenicity. 1 EMA. WebIn the field of pharmacology, potency is a measure of drug activity expressed in terms of the amount required to produce an effect of given intensity. WebApr 13, 2024 · A “potency assay” for a vaccine is, in reality, a biological activity assay that is a surrogate for immune response to be elicited by the antigen. This is typically a product and/or platform ... WebMay 5, 2024 · A potency or potency-indicating assay is a regulatory requirement for the release of every lot of a vaccine. Potency is a critical quality attribute that is also monitored as a stability indicator ...
